重新使用/重新启动相同的节点检查会话

Ste*_*ord 22 node.js google-chrome-devtools

一旦node.js程序在--inspect会话的上下文中运行完成(即通过Chrome开发工具调试器),就可以重新启动它而无需从命令重新发出--inspect命令-线?

重新发出--inspect命令的问题在于,它每次都会生成一个不同的chrome网址,然后每次都必须将其复制粘贴到Chrome中.理想情况下,我希望能够推动F5重新启动chrome调试会话.

所以有两个问题:

  1. 我不能在不杀死当前的情况下重新启动调试会话(即无法刷新).
  2. 每次开始新会话时,我都必须将网址粘贴到chrome中.(没有问题1那么糟糕)

Art*_*f3x 18

这里有几个选项,虽然它们都不会为您提供简单的F5刷新,两者都明显优于复制/粘贴--inspect标志生成的新URL.

最佳解决方案是为Chrome或Opera安装此扩展程序:https: //chrome.google.com/webstore/detail/nim-node-inspector-manage/gnhhdgbaldcilmgcpfddgdbkhjohddkj

NIM(节点检查员经理)

这将为您管理节点检查器.只需单击生成的工具栏图标,然后从切换开关中选择"自动".然后,只要节点服务器生成检查URL,您的浏览器就会以检查模式打开Chrome DevTools.

如果你想使用低技术(和更多手动)路线,或者不想安装Chrome扩展程序,只需打开你的Chrome浏览器"chrome:// inspect",等一下,你就会得到一个远程目标下的列表,其中包括您的节点服务器.只需单击那里的"inspect"链接,DevTools就会打开当前的URL.这种方法的缺点是,每次服务器重新启动时,您都需要重新点击"检查"链接.它避免了复制/粘贴URL,但仍涉及手工劳动.

铬:检查方法